What is Classic Coleslaw?
Classic Coleslaw is a traditional salad made primarily from finely shredded raw cabbage and dressed most commonly with a vinaigrette or mayonnaise. This dish is characterized by its crunchy texture and creamy dressing, making it a go-to side for barbecues, picnics, and potlucks. It is often enhanced with additional ingredients like carrots, onions, and various seasonings to cater to different palates.

How to Make Classic Coleslaw Step by Step
- Begin by finely shredding the **green cabbage** and **carrots**. Use a sharp knife or a mandoline for even cuts.
- In a large bowl, combine the shredded cabbage and carrots.
- In a separate bowl, whisk together the **mayonnaise**, **apple cider vinegar**, **sugar**, **salt**, and **black pepper** until smooth.
- Pour the dressing over the cabbage and carrots, tossing until everything is well coated.
- Cover the bowl and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to allow flavors to meld.
- Serve chilled, and enjoy your Classic Coleslaw!
Pro Tip: For a creamier texture, let the dressing sit for a few minutes before adding it to the vegetables.
Expert Tips for Best Results
- Use fresh, crisp **cabbage** for the best texture and flavor.
- For added crunch, consider mixing in some thinly sliced **bell peppers** or **radishes**.
- Adjust the sugar level based on your taste preferences; some prefer a sweeter coleslaw while others enjoy it more tangy.
- Letting the coleslaw sit in the fridge allows the flavors to develop, so it’s best to prepare it a few hours in advance.
- If you’re looking for a lighter option, substitute half of the mayonnaise with Greek yogurt.
- Experiment with adding herbs like **parsley** or **dill** for an additional flavor layer.
Variations and Substitutions
- Vegan Option: Substitute mayonnaise with a vegan alternative or make your own with blended silken tofu.
- Spicy Kick: Add a dash of hot sauce or diced jalapeños for an extra kick.
- Fruit-Infused: Mix in diced apples or raisins for a sweet and fruity twist.
- Herbed Coleslaw: Incorporate fresh herbs like cilantro or mint for a refreshing herbal flavor.

Description
A creamy, crunchy, and refreshing classic coleslaw that pairs perfectly with any barbecue or picnic dish.
Ingredients
- 4 cups green cabbage
- 1 cup carrots
- 1/2 cup mayonnaise
- 2 tablespoons apple cider vinegar
- 1 tablespoon sugar
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
Instructions
- In a large bowl, combine the shredded cabbage and carrots.
- In a separate small bowl, whisk together the mayonnaise, apple cider vinegar, sugar, salt, and black pepper until smooth.
- Pour the dressing over the cabbage and carrots, and toss until well combined.
- Chill in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es before serving to allow the flavors to meld.
- Serve cold as a side dish or topping for sandwiches.
Notes
- For a tangier flavor, add more vinegar to taste.
- This coleslaw can be made a day in advance; just keep it covered in the refrigerator.
